Every floral arrangement tells a story, and the flower bag is part of that narrative. Different occasions call for different moods, styles, and levels of formality, making the choice of flower bag an important decision for florists and gift providers.
For romantic occasions such as anniversaries or Valentine’s Day, flower bags with soft tones, elegant finishes, and graceful shapes help convey warmth and emotion. These designs enhance the sentimental value of the bouquet and create a sense of intimacy that aligns with the moment being celebrated.
Celebratory events like birthdays, graduations, or promotions often benefit from brighter colors and more playful designs. A well-chosen flower bag can amplify the joy of the occasion, making the gift feel lively and thoughtful. In these cases, visual impact is key—bold contrasts and clean structure help the bouquet stand out.
Corporate and formal events require a different approach. Flower bags used in professional settings should communicate refinement and restraint. Neutral colors, structured silhouettes, and understated finishes help maintain a polished appearance that aligns with corporate branding and etiquette. Such packaging reinforces professionalism while still allowing the flowers to shine.
Seasonality also plays a role in selecting the right flower bag. Lighter materials and fresh colors work well for spring and summer, while richer tones and sturdier designs feel more appropriate for autumn and winter arrangements. Adapting packaging to the season shows attention to detail and enhances the overall customer experience.
By carefully matching flower bags to occasions, businesses can create a stronger emotional connection with their customers. The right packaging not only protects the flowers but also reinforces the message behind the gift, turning a simple bouquet into a meaningful experience.
